Output 0c20ee8d71de2feb30b973975d10e650af99bb0a8bfb286370f58c03711077af:2

value
1659965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aef4775ce580387260d00f219086a34cac0b23c1 OP_EQUAL
address
3He6MjdgZyi1khGwgrfwAEUvKqmyVJr1Dq
transaction
0c20ee8d71de2feb30b973975d10e650af99bb0a8bfb286370f58c03711077af
confirmations
362027
spent
true